Peter Eisentraut wrote: > On fre, 2010-12-17 at 12:57 +0100, Magnus Hagander wrote: > > The limit on max_standby_streaming_delay is currently 35 minutes > > (around) - or you have to set it to unlimited. This is because the GUC > > is limited to MAX_INT/1000, unit milliseconds. > > > > Is there a reason for the /1000, or is it just an oversight thinking > > the unit was in seconds? > > Yeah, I actually noticed this week that log_min_duration_statement is > limited to the same 35 minutes for the same reason. Might be good to > address that, too. Note that statement_timeout does not have that > limit.
